Transaction 2e32617875fdd022410c26b4a5b8cccd799b7eb803edaa1cd28c8f54c0baf3d9
1 Input
1 Output
-
2e32617875fdd022410c26b4a5b8cccd799b7eb803edaa1cd28c8f54c0baf3d9:0
- value
- 3899708
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c946d6dff42a82c12744921099422e9d6cb590eae439d33ea1f0b4c3387df23f
- address
- bc1pe9rddhl592pvzf6yjggfjs3wn4ktty82usuax04p7z6vxwra7glsakz86z